首页 >Java >java教程 >tomcat404怎么解决

tomcat404怎么解决

百草
百草原创
2023-12-27 15:35:4410042浏览

tomcat404的解决办法:1、检查URL是否正确;2、检查Web应用程序是否正确部署;3、检查web.xml文件;4、检查端口号是否正确;5、检查Tomcat日志文件;6、检查文件和目录权限;7、重新启动Tomcat服务器;8、检查网络连接;9、更新Tomcat版本;10、查找相关问题。详细介绍:1、检查URL是否正确,首先确认访问的URL是否正确等等。

tomcat404怎么解决

本教程操作系统:windows10系统、DELL G3电脑。

遇到Tomcat返回404错误时,可以尝试以下几种解决方法:

1、检查URL是否正确:首先确认访问的URL是否正确,是否与实际部署的Web应用程序的路径匹配。有时候由于路径错误或拼写错误,可能会导致404错误。

2、检查Web应用程序是否正确部署:确保Web应用程序已经正确解压或部署到Tomcat的webapps目录下。如果应用程序未正确部署,Tomcat将无法找到对应的资源,从而导致404错误。

3、检查web.xml文件:Web应用程序的根目录下应该有一个web.xml文件,它是Web应用程序的部署描述符。检查web.xml文件是否存在,内容是否正确,特别是标签内的内容是否符合规范。

4、检查端口号是否正确:默认情况下,Tomcat使用8080端口号。如果修改了Tomcat的端口号,需要确保在访问URL时使用了正确的端口号。检查Tomcat配置文件(如server.xml)中的端口号设置,确保与实际使用的端口号一致。

5、检查Tomcat日志文件:Tomcat的日志文件可能包含有关404错误的更多详细信息。检查Tomcat日志文件(如catalina.out或localhost.log),查找与404错误相关的日志条目,以获取更多线索。

6、检查文件和目录权限:确保Tomcat进程具有足够的权限来访问应用程序目录和文件。有时候,权限问题可能导致Tomcat无法访问资源,从而导致404错误。

7、重新启动Tomcat服务器:有时候,简单地重新启动Tomcat服务器可以解决一些暂时性的问题。尝试关闭Tomcat服务器,然后重新启动它,看看问题是否得到解决。

8、检查网络连接:如果Tomcat服务器部署在网络上,确保网络连接正常,并且防火墙或其他安全设置没有阻止对Tomcat服务器的访问。

9、更新Tomcat版本:有时候,某些版本的Tomcat可能存在已知的问题或漏洞。尝试更新到最新版本的Tomcat,看看问题是否得到解决。

10、查找相关问题:使用搜索引擎或相关论坛搜索关于Tomcat 404错误的信息,可能会找到其他用户遇到相同问题的解决方案或建议。

如果以上方法都没有解决问题,建议提供更多关于错误的详细信息,如完整的错误消息、日志文件内容、Tomcat配置等,以便更好地诊断和解决问题。同时,也可以考虑寻求专业人士的帮助或在相关论坛上寻求帮助。

以上是tomcat404怎么解决的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n